Output 91efb3d2213788aac27d7d26ab434a543eb4a422c81c395956a8c9fa72202a3a:3

value
68502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c906d0d653d59cbba256ca8c99fdac0f3d6ba4 OP_EQUAL
address
3Kp6Y6oe3KsfTyiZD6FsH34SyhuuwUQyHL
transaction
91efb3d2213788aac27d7d26ab434a543eb4a422c81c395956a8c9fa72202a3a
spent
true